Cherry Strike is an ability that is only usable in Boss Mode of Plants vs. Zombies: Garden Warfare if the player is on the plant side. It costs 250 sun to deploy. Each Cherry Bomb can deal up to 70 damage which is a critical hit. Its zombie counterpart is the Cone Strike. It takes 45 seconds to recharge.

Strategies
The Cherry Strike is very hard to aim with, as most of the time, it falls at the wrong location or the zombies move away before it explodes. The best and possibly only time recommended to use the Cherry Strike is when a garden in Gardens & Graveyards or Gnome Bomb is full of zombies. Otherwise, you may miss your target and waste 250 sun.

Trivia
- They use the design of the Cherry Bomb in Plants vs. Zombies, although some icons in the game are from Plants vs. Zombies 2.
- When a player vanquishes a zombie in Multiplayer with this, it says the player used "Crazy Dave Airstrike".
